This suit is instituted on behalf of the Plaintiff inter alia seeking a decree of permanent injunction restraining the Defendant and all others acting on its behalf from manufacturing, packaging, selling, offering for sale, advertising and dealing, in any manner whatsoever, with the impugned mark/label / or any other mark which may be identical and/or deceptively similar to Plaintiff's trademarks/labels TODAY STAR/TODAY PREMIUM/ / , amounting to CS(COMM) 741/2025 The authenticity of the order can be re-verified from Delhi High Court Order Portal by scanning the QR code shown above. The Order is downloaded from the DHC Server on 29/05/2026 at 13:26:47

infringement of Plaintiff's registered trademarks. 2.

During the pendency of the suit, parties were referred for mediation before the Delhi High Court Mediation and Conciliation Centre, where they have amicably settled their inter se disputes and executed a Settlement Agreement dated 23.03.2026, incorporating the terms of settlement, copy of which has been placed on record.

3.

Court has perused the terms of settlement and finds the same to be lawful. Accordingly, the suit is decreed in terms of the settlement. The Settlement Agreement shall form a part of the decree and terms thereof shall bind the parties thereto.

4.

Registry is directed to draw up the decree sheet. 5.

Suit along with pending application stands disposed of. 6.

Plaintiff is held entitled to refund of entire court fees in accordance with Court Fees Act, 1870.
